According to Portuguese journalist Pedro Almeida, Tottenham Hotspur are making a surprise deadline day attempt to snap up Wolves midfielder Ruben Neves.
Tottenham look set to have quite a busy transfer deadline day, with at least one new signing in Emerson Royal set to arrive through the door.
The Lilywhites have also been heavily linked with a move for Adama Traore over the last week and despite suggestions that Wolves are not prepared to sell the winger, the North Londoners have allegedly not given up their pursuit of the Spaniard.
It has now emerged that Tottenham are also making a sensational attempt to sign Traore’s Wolves teammate, Neves.
Almeida revealed that the North London club are currently negotiating personal terms with the Portuguese international, who is said to be valued by Wolves at €40m (£34.3m).
However, the journalist added that Manchester United are also involved in the race to sign Neves on transfer deadline day.
